Crockpot Chicken Noodle Soup

  • Total Time: 6 hours 10 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ings

Description

This crockpot chicken noodle soup is the ultimate cozy comfort food. Tender chicken, hearty noodles, and rich broth make it the perfect remedy for cold days and stuffy noses.


Ingredients

1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ts

6 cups chicken broth

2 carrots, sliced

2 celery stalks, sliced

1 onion, diced

2 garlic cloves, minced

1 tsp dried thyme

1 tsp dried parsley

Salt and pepper, to taste

2 cups egg noodles

Fresh parsley, for garnish


Instructions

Add chicken, chicken broth, carrots, celery, onion, garlic, thyme, and parsley to the Crockpot.

Cover and cook on low for 6–8 hours or high for 3–4 hours, until the chicken is tender.

Remove the chicken, shred it with two forks, then return it to the Crockpot.

Add egg noodles and cook on high for 20–30 minutes, until noodles are soft.

Season with salt and pepper to taste,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ve hot.

Notes

You can substitute chicken thighs for chicken breasts for a richer flavor.

Use wide egg noodles for a more traditional texture.

If the soup thickens too much, add a little more broth before serving.

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3–4 days or frozen for up to 3 months.
